A law will be subject to strict scrutiny if it: a. requires agencies to adopt affirmative action programs. b. involves denying v

oting rights to minors and illegal immigrants. c. permits marriage between same-sex members. d. requires eligible voters to register online. e. encompasses suspect classification.

Answer:

<em>A law will be subject to </em><em><u>strict scrutiny</u></em><em> if it </em><em>e. encompasses suspect classification.</em>

Explanation:

In US law, <u>strict scrutiny</u> is applied when the legislature have passed a law that infringes upon a fundamental right or one that involves suspect classification.

<u>Suspect classification</u> refers to a classification that was likely based on illegal discrimination, such as one based on race, nationality, alienage or religion.
